The Barcelona-Real Madrid La Liga match, this Sunday, May 11th at 4:30 p.m., is an unmissable global event. If the Catalans win the match, they will have a clear shot at the Spanish league title. If their rivals from Madrid win, the championship will be fully relaunched. Regardless of the outcome, rapper Travis Scott can already savor the success of his three-way collaboration with FC Barcelona and the streaming platform Spotify.
For the Clásico, Lamine Yamal and his teammates, eliminated this week by Inter in the Champions League, will wear a brand new jersey. It will be in Barça's traditional colors, with a sponsor printed with "Cactus Jack," temporarily replacing the Spotify logo, which sits in the center of the jersey. Sold at €400 each, the 1,899 copies of the jersey – a figure that refers to the year of its founding – were made.
